How long is a Dentist Cleaning?
Generally speaking, a dentist’s cleaning takes about thirty minutes. However, if you have an unusual mouth or teeth that require care, the dentist may take a little longer to ensure that all necessary work is done. For example, if you are seeing a new dentist and they want to see how everything is growing in or have not seen your mouth for a long time because of moving around. They will take additional time to ensure it is all healthy.
